These early flasks frequently included decorative components which stood for the saints of the holy sites they went to. However, it wasn't up until the 18th century that we begin to see the introduction of the flask as we understand it today. This is due in big part to improvements in the purification process, which made it feasible to generate the kind of alcohol that can stand up to lengthy journeys without spoiling.
The flask played a significant role throughout the 1920's when America established restriction legislations stopping the manufacturing, circulation or usage of alcohol throughout the country. Not surprisingly, together with the speakeasy, the popularity of the flask rose as males and ladies flouted legislations, carrying flasks of bourbon and rum underneath their clothing to nip at, share and sell.
Typically a glass blown flask made primarily in the Northeast by Masons themselves for the Lodge conferences where participants were expected to bring their very own alcohol. These flasks can be identified by the Masonic icons embossed onto the glass during the production procedure. No discussion of the flask is full without an introduction of the materials made use of to make them.
Glass, Dating back to 5000-3500 BCE, blown glass has actually been utilized as a container for liquids, the majority of commonly used in the Masonic flasks mentioned over. Today's glass flasks are usually integrated with a metal cap and base to enhance the delicate glass itself. Stainless-steel, The most preferred product utilized today is stainless-steel because of its price and stamina.

Of the products pointed out here, stainless-steel is without a doubt the most sturdy, scrape and taint immune and keeps it's high gloss for many years. Pewter, A malleable steel alloy that goes back to the Bronze Age, pewter is more costly than stainless steel yet cheaper than sterling silver. Noted for its unique patinaparticularly in older flasks, which have actually tainted and oxidized transforming the steel a dark greya pewter flask typically has that unique appearance of a typical heirloom piece.
